In children under the age of 5 years, no calcification is present but prevalence increases rapidly with age, reaching a plateau at about 30 years of age 5. WebThe pineal gland, conarium, or epiphysis cerebri, is a small endocrine gland in the brain of most vertebrates.The pineal gland produces melatonin, a serotonin-derived hormone which modulates sleep patterns in both circadian and seasonal cycles.The shape of the gland resembles a pine cone, which gives it its name. Why the Pineal gland calcifies is unclear. The chemical composition of the calcium build up is calcium phosphate/carbonate and magnesium phosphate.
